What is a contract RV transport driver?

A Contract RV Transport Driver is an independent contractor responsible for delivering recreational vehicles (RVs) from manufacturers or dealerships to customers or other locations. These drivers use their own trucks to tow RVs, typically under a non-employee agreement. They handle trip planning, fuel costs, and any necessary expenses while ensuring safe and timely deliveries. This role offers flexibility but requires meeting company requirements, maintaining a reliable vehicle, and adhering to transport regulations.

What does a contract RV transport driver do?

A typical workweek for a Contract RV Transport Driver often involves planning routes, inspecting assigned RV units for damage, securing loads, and delivering vehicles to designated locations across long distances. You may work independently most of the time but will frequently communicate with dispatchers and clients regarding schedules and delivery updates. Hours can vary depending on contracts, and you may spend several days on the road at a time. Flexibility and self-direction are important, as the job often requires adapting to changing delivery assignments and weather conditions.

What skills and qualifications are needed to be a contract RV transport driver?

To thrive as a Contract RV Transport Driver, you need a valid commercial driver's license (often a Class A or B CDL), a clean driving record, and proven experience in towing or transporting large vehicles. Familiarity with electronic logging devices (ELDs), GPS navigation systems, and Department of Transportation (DOT) safety regulations is essential. Excellent time management, customer service orientation, and problem-solving abilities distinguish top performers in this role. These skills are critical for delivering RVs efficiently and safely while ensuring positive client interactions and regulatory compliance.
